Nestled amidst the lush landscapes of Maharashtra, the Bhavali Dam is a stunning example of how human ingenuity and nature can coexist harmoniously. This impressive structure, with its expansive reservoir and scenic surroundings, serves as a vital water source while offering a serene escape for nature lovers and travelers.

Built across the Bhavali River, the dam plays a crucial role in irrigation, ensuring water supply to the surrounding agricultural lands. Its reservoir supports local farmers by sustaining crop production, thereby boosting the rural economy. By mitigating water scarcity, Bhavali Dam stands as a symbol of sustainable resource management and community well-being.
Surrounded by rolling hills and verdant valleys, the Bhavali Dam showcases remarkable engineering excellence. Constructed with precision and durability in mind, the dam is designed to withstand the forces of nature while securing the livelihoods of the downstream population. Its massive reservoir stretches across vast areas, offering a spectacular view that seamlessly blends man-made structures with the beauty of nature.
Beyond its functional purpose, Bhavali Dam has become a favored retreat for travelers seeking peace and natural beauty. The reservoir’s calm waters invite visitors to enjoy activities like boating and fishing, while nearby viewpoints and picnic spots offer breathtaking panoramic views. The area’s tranquility provides an ideal setting for relaxation and unwinding away from urban life.
Conservation initiatives around the dam ensure the protection of its surrounding ecosystem. Reforestation efforts and sustainable water management practices help maintain biodiversity, while educational programs raise awareness about environmental preservation. The continued focus on sustainability highlights the importance of balancing human needs with ecological responsibility.
The Bhavali Dam is not just a water reservoir; it is a testament to human progress and environmental stewardship. Whether you are a traveler in search of scenic landscapes or someone interested in understanding the significance of water conservation, Bhavali Dam offers an enriching experience. As it continues to support local communities and provide a picturesque retreat, this marvel of engineering remains a beacon of sustainability and harmony between mankind and nature.
